Common Emergency Dental Procedures and Rates
Emergency dental services generally consist of procedures such as extractions, dental fillings, and origin canals, each with varying linked prices. Removals, where a tooth is removed, can range from $75 to $450 per tooth depending on the complexity. Fillings, utilized to treat dental caries, commonly expense between $100 to $300 per filling. Origin canals, a procedure to deal with infected tooth pulp, may vary from $500 to $1500 per tooth.

Tips for Handling Emergency Dental Expenses
To better navigate unanticipated oral prices, consider executing functional techniques for handling emergency oral costs effectively. To start with, see to it to have oral insurance policy or an oral savings plan in place. These options can help in reducing the financial concern of emergency situation treatments.
Furthermore, some dental practitioners provide in-house funding or layaway plan, which can make it less complicated to cover the expenses gradually.
An additional pointer is to check out alternate treatment alternatives with your dentist. In some cases, there might be a lot more budget friendly alternatives that still resolve your dental emergency effectively. It's also essential to prioritize your dental wellness to stop future emergency situations.
Routine dental exams and exercising great oral hygiene can help stay clear of expensive emergency situation treatments in the long run.
Last but not least, take into consideration reserving a little reserve especially for oral costs. Having an economic barrier for unexpected oral costs can offer satisfaction and guarantee you're planned for any type of future emergencies.
